Made it back safely from Europe. No raping and murdering occurred. Drove and RV camped from Berlin south through Dresden, then from Prague to Cesky Krumlov. Went to Austria, stayed in the Wachau Valley and Vienna. Took a train into Budapest, then drove through Poland and stopped in Krakow. Awesome trip, saw way too many cathedrals and old shit, but they were awesome. Drank beer in all countries. People online talked how great Czech beer is, and it was good, but it doesn't compare to German beer. Took a boat ride down the Danube and Kayaked down the Vlatava River. As we all know, Germany and Austria are very relaxed with nudity, cracked me up when we saw two guys sunbathing naked in the park in Berlin and people just hanging out naked on the side of the road in Austria.
All the people were awesome that we met, even the grumpy Russian fellow that ran the camp ground in Berlin. Didnt see any No Go Zones. Asked a few people about them and they never heard of them. Saw Muslims there, but they were doing what everybody else was doing, sightseeing and trying to get from point A to B, or what everybody does.
European drivers are 100% better drivers than Americans, drive fast but move to the right lane when not passing and they only pass on the left. Very courteous drivers. If you needed to get in a lane, they slowed down to allow you to. Great Trip. I'll post some pictures when i get the off of my phone.
BTW, had a 17 hour layover in Iceland, only saw Reykjavik, cool little town, but the two things i came away with was Iceland is by far the most expensive city i've been to. Beer was 12 bucks.
